Once an organization decides that some process should stop being done by hand, the next decision is who does the automating. There are four honest answers, and each is right for someone. The mistake is picking by habit: hiring because that is what you did last time, or calling a consultant because a consultant called you.

The four options

Do it yourself

Someone on the team learns the tools and builds it. Cheapest in cash, slowest in calendar, and the most common way automation projects stall. Without a guide, the first hard problem (an integration that needs credentials nobody has, a data field that is never clean) becomes the place the project stops.

Right when: the process is small, the tool you already own can do it, and the person has the time and the curiosity.

Hire an AI automation consultant

Someone who has done this many times scopes, builds, or guides the build. The good ones baseline before they build, teach as they go, and leave documentation. The bad ones leave a black box and a retainer. The difference is visible in how they talk about measurement and ownership before the contract is signed.

Right when: you want the result in weeks, you want your people to understand it, and the scope is one to three automations at a time.

Hire a development shop

A firm builds custom software to a specification. Strong when the thing you need has its own home: a portal, a platform, a product. Weak when the thing you need is an integration between two tools you already pay for; a dev shop will often propose rebuilding one of them.

Right when: the workflow is part of what you sell, or the volume has outgrown every off-the-shelf tool, and you have someone who can own the specification.

Hire an engineer

A full-time salary, months to ramp, and then capacity for everything. Right for a company whose product is software. Overkill for most internal automation, where the work is bursty: a month of building, then a quarter of nothing.

What each costs beyond the invoice

The invoice is the easy part. The costs that decide whether the project was worth it are these.

  • Your time. Every option needs a person on your side who knows the process and can test. DIY needs the most; a dev shop needs a specification owner; a consultant needs two to four hours a week.
  • Dependency. Who can change it in six months when the process shifts? If the answer is "only the people we paid," every change is a purchase order.
  • Knowledge. Did anyone on your team learn how it works? Learning is the cheapest insurance against dependency.
  • Measurement. Will you know what it returned? Without a baseline and a log, you will not, and neither will the person who approved the budget.

What each should cost, in shape

Prices vary too much by region and scope to quote here, but the shape of the price tells you a great deal about the relationship you are entering.

A consultant should quote a fixed fee for scoping and a fixed fee or a short monthly rate for the build, with the baseline named in the scope. An hourly rate with no ceiling means the incentive runs the wrong way: the longer it takes, the more they earn.

A dev shop should quote a fixed build fee against a written specification, then a separate monthly figure for hosting and support. Be wary of a low build fee paired with a vague support contract; the support contract is where the money is made, and where your dependency lives.

An engineer costs a salary plus benefits plus the months before they are productive, and then costs that every month whether there is work or not. For a company that is not a software company, that is the most expensive option per automation by a wide margin, and it only makes sense when the backlog is deep enough to fill a year.

Doing it yourself costs the time of the person doing it, valued at their loaded rate, plus the cost of the project stalling. That second number is usually larger than the first, and it never shows up on an invoice.

Whatever the shape, insist on one thing in writing: a baseline before the build and a ledger after it. If the seller will not commit to measuring the result, the price is a guess about a guess.

Questions to ask any of them

Ask before you sign
  • Will you baseline the process before building, and how?
  • Who owns the code, the data, and the accounts it runs under?
  • What happens when we stop paying you? What do we keep, and what breaks?
  • How will we know what it saved, and how often will we see that number?
  • Which of our people will understand how it works when you are gone?

A consultant, shop, or candidate who answers all five plainly is worth talking to. One who changes the subject to the technology is selling the technology.

A fifth option: build the capability

The four options above assume automation is a project. For organizations with more than a handful of processes worth automating, it is closer to a capability, and capabilities are built, not bought. A structured program where your own people scope, build, and measure automations, with coaching, produces the automations and the people who can build the next ones.
